Job Description

Pariveda is seeking an entry-level software engineer to join small consulting teams supported by mentors and a structured career path. The role focuses on delivering technology solutions across cloud, data engineering, DevOps, and AI in a hybrid working model.

Role Overview

As a Pariveda Consultant, you will collaborate with Pariveda employees and partner with clients to address real business challenges. Work is performed with guidance from a dedicated mentor, along with a defined path for growth. You will develop, test, and manage projects and contribute to solution architecture and delivery.

Key Responsibilities

  • Work in small teams, coordinating with Pariveda employees and partnering with clients to solve business problems.
  • Develop through mentorship and a defined career path, including performance reviews every 6 months and promotion eligibility every 12 months.
  • Learn to estimate, gather requirements, develop, test, manage projects, and architect and deliver solutions.
  • Explore and apply technologies across cloud and data engineering, including AWS, Azure, Google Cloud, Databricks, and PySpark.
  • Apply DevOps practices such as CI/CD, Docker, and Terraform.
  • Build AI and Generative AI solutions using RAG, LLMs on Azure OpenAI and AWS Bedrock, prompt engineering, and agent frameworks including LangChain.
  • Use AI strategically to improve client solutions while communicating the value, limitations, and ethical use of AI to clients and stakeholders.
  • Strengthen professional communication skills by creating and presenting findings, solutions, and demos to technical and non-technical audiences, including senior executives and stakeholders.
  • Participate in a hybrid work model.
  • Engage in a culture of continuous learning, community service, social gatherings, and personal and professional development.
  • Work with supportive, humble, and collaborative teammates.

Compensation

  • USD 79,800 - 91,800 per year
  • Entry-level salary is $79,800, with cost of labor increases for Los Angeles, New York, San Francisco, Seattle, and Washington DC markets.

Benefits

  •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ance for you and your family
  • Employer Health Savings Account (HSA) contribution
  • 2% 401(k), vested immediately
  • Company ownership via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P)
  • Paid Time Off: 4 weeks of vacation time, 10 holidays, and 1 floating holiday
  • Paid sabbatical after 5 years of service for Principals and above
  • Paid parental leave; breast milk shipping costs reimbursed for work travel
  • Employee Assistance Program (EAP), health concierge, and financial wellness tool
  • Company-paid cell phone plan and device stipend
  • Life insurance
  • Short-Term and Long-Term Disability
